The best use case for Infrastructure as a Service (IaaS) is the scenario involving lifting and shifting on-premises systems to the cloud with minimal changes. This is because IaaS offers virtualized computing resources over the internet, allowing businesses to migrate their existing applications and systems with little to no modification. This model supports the replication of an existing infrastructure in the cloud, where organizations can take advantage of the scalability and flexibility of cloud resources while retaining their current operations and workflows.

By utilizing IaaS, organizations can effectively transition their workloads to the cloud without the need for extensive reconfiguration or redesign, thus minimizing disruption to their operations. The infrastructure provided is highly customizable, which means that businesses can tailor the computing environments to suit specific requirements while still benefiting from cloud advantages like remote access, automatic scaling, and infrastructure management.

In contrast, hosting websites without server management aligns more closely with Platform as a Service (PaaS), which abstracts server management tasks and simplifies application deployment. Rapidly creating complex applications in the cloud typically leverages PaaS or SaaS models, where the focus is on application development rather than infrastructure management.
